4. Partial Discharge / Insulation Integrity Tester – Detect concealed Weaknesses
https://www.chromaate.com/
manufacturer & product: Chroma 19500 Series Partial Discharge Tester (e.g., 19501-K)
Why this class matters:
even though a battery pack passes simple insulation or hipot checks, very small inner defects or micro-voids can cause partial discharge, main over time to insulation failure or security incidents.
Pain-points solved:
Undetected micro-faults and insulation breakdown mechanisms
unforeseen reliability failures and guarantee threat
Benchmark highlights (19501-K):
High voltage output (0.1 kV to ten kV AC)
Partial discharge measurement selection one pC-2000 Computer system
Compliant with IEC60270-one and IEC60747-five-5 standards
When to settle on it:
significant-voltage pack enhancement (e.g., >400 V)
security qualification labs
variety checklist:
most voltage will have to exceed your pack’s isolation take a look at voltage
PD detection resolution (Personal computer) related in your insulation course
Remote control / automation capacity (LAN, USB, RS-232)
Compliance to suitable benchmarks

regularly questioned Questions (FAQ)
Q1: Do I want both a performance tester and a security tester?
Certainly. overall performance testers (charge/discharge programs) validate capability, cycle existence and behavior. protection testers (hipot, insulation, partial discharge) confirm electrical security and prolonged-term dependability. the two are essential for a complete lab.
Q2: the number of channels ought to a battery pack tester have?
It is dependent upon your workflow. For pack-degree tests you could possibly will need 1–four substantial-ability channels; for mobile level R&D you may scale to eight–16 channels or parallel modules. Start with flexibility and Create up.
Q3: What software features are crucial for effectiveness?
seek out multi-channel synchronized control, information export (CSV/Excel), craze Evaluation, automated exam sequencing and remote monitoring. These options lessen handbook overhead and boost lab throughput.
This autumn: How vital is environmental robustness (temperature/humidity) for screening machines?
important. Ambient ailments have an effect on the two batteries and take a look at devices. fantastic testers support large temperature/humidity ranges, cooling and thermal checking.
Q5: How should really I prioritize funds? Which instrument comes to start with?
get started with the performance tester (demand/discharge process) because it sorts the lab’s spine. Then insert safety and insulation devices, accompanied by System/integration upgrades.
